A gasoline tank in a standard automobile (filling hole diameter = 4 in) contains 15 gal of gasoline and can be filled in about 5 min. The molecular weight of gasoline is 92, and its vapor pressure at 77°F is 4.6 psi. Estimate the concentration (in ppm) of gasoline vapor as result of this filling operation. Assume a ventilation rate of 3000 ft3/min. TLV for gasoline is 300 ppm. Diffusion coefficient of water at 77°F is 1.63 ft/min. Assume an adjustment factor is 0.5.
